Understanding UPI Payments: A Beginner's Introduction
UPI, or Unified System, is quickly a common option to send online remittances in the country. In simple terms, it allows you to transfer funds immediately from one banking deposit to a person's account via a phone. As opposed to traditional methods, UPI doesn't necessitate the providing of financial details; instead, you employ a unique UPI ID, consisting of can be your phone number, virtual address, or the specially UPI address. This is very convenient for sharing expenses with friends or completing minor transactions.
Top UPI Payment Apps in India
Navigating the digital payment landscape in India has become significantly easier thanks to the rise of Unified Payments Interfaces (UPI). Numerous services now offer UPI functionality, but which are truly the best? Several contenders consistently rank high, including copyright, known for its intuitive interface and wide range of offers; Google Pay, lauded for its seamless integration with Google services and easy expense splitting; and Paytm, a established name offering a complete monetary ecosystem. BHIM also deserves mention, being a government-backed project providing a secure and dependable option. Furthermore, banks like HDFC, ICICI, and State Bank of India often have their own UPI systems providing additional advantages to their customers. Ultimately, the finest choice depends on individual needs and desired features.

Unified Payments Interface App Features & Advantages
The modern UPI platform has revolutionized how Indians process their financial transactions, offering a range of innovative features and significant benefits. Beyond the essential functionality of instant money remittances, many UPI systems now provide extra options like QR code payments, utility payments, check requests, and even allow for linking multiple financial accounts. Customers can receive increased ease due to the elimination of the need for traditional money or complicated documents. Furthermore, UPI fosters digital inclusion by providing payments easy to individuals with varying levels of financial understanding. The safe nature of UPI, with its layered security protocols, further improves to its value as a leading payment method.
